Understanding Jeep Wrangler
The Jeep Wrangler is a well-known and versatile vehicle popular among off-road enthusiasts. It is a compact SUV that handles rough terrain and challenging driving conditions. The Wrangler is available in several models, including the Sport, Sahara, and Rubicon, each with unique features and capabilities.
One of the most notable characteristics of the Jeep Wrangler is its open-air design. The vehicle’s removable top and doors allow drivers and passengers to experience the outdoors while still enjoying the comfort and convenience of a car. This feature also makes it easy to store and transport large items, such as camping gear or sports equipment.
Another key feature of the Jeep Wrangler is its four-wheel drive system, which provides excellent traction and stability on uneven terrain. This system allows drivers to easily tackle steep hills, rocky trails, and other challenging obstacles. The Wrangler also has a high ground clearance and sturdy suspension, further enhancing its off-road capabilities.

Exhaust and Suspension Upgrades
Upgrading your Jeep Wrangler’s exhaust and suspension can have a significant impact on its performance and handling. Here are some upgrades you can consider:
Exhaust Upgrades
Upgrading your Wrangler’s exhaust system can improve its horsepower and torque, as well as its sound. A new exhaust system can also increase fuel efficiency and reduce emissions. You can choose from a wide selection of heavy-duty aluminized and stainless steel exhaust systems that range from moderate to aggressive tones.
Suspension Upgrades
Your Wrangler’s suspension is equally important on pavement and on harsh trails. From preventing roll-overs to preventing the infamous death wobble, keeping your suspension up to par could save your Jeep and your hide. Here are some suspension upgrades to consider:
- Lift Kits: Lift kits can increase your Wrangler’s ground clearance and allow you to install larger tires. You can choose from leveling kits, which raise the front of your Jeep to match the rear, or full lift kits which raise both the front and rear.
- Shocks: Upgraded shocks can improve your Wrangler’s ride quality and handling, especially off-road. You can choose from monotube or twin-tube shocks that are designed to handle different terrains.
- Coil Spring Spacers: Coil spring spacers can provide a cost-effective way to increase your Wrangler’s ride height without changing its suspension geometry.
- Long Arm Upgrade Kits: Long arm upgrade kits can improve your Wrangler’s articulation and suspension travel, making it more capable off-road.
- Bump Stops: Bump stops can prevent your Wrangler’s suspension from bottoming out and damaging its components.
- Slip Yoke Eliminator Kits: Slip yoke eliminator kits can improve your Wrangler’s driveline angle, reducing vibrations and wear.
- Steering and Steering Stabilizers: Upgraded steering components and steering stabilizers can improve your Wrangler’s handling and reduce steering wander.
Overall, upgrading your Wrangler’s exhaust and suspension can improve its performance and handling both on and off the road. However, it’s important to choose the right upgrades for your specific needs and budget.
